Use NHS 111 if:

 
  • You need help now, but it's not an emergency
  • You need support with your mental health
  • You need help finding a Pharmacy

There will be someone to provide you with advice and to direct you to a clinician if it is necessary.

Call 999 or go to A&E now if:

 
  • you or someone you know needs immediate help
  • you have seriously harmed yourself - for example, by taking a drug overdose

A mental health emergency should be taken as seriously as a medical emergency.
